Associated with St. John Hospital System and William Beaumont Hospital, Dr. Paul earned his bachelor of science of pharmacy at the Wayne State College of Pharmacy and Allied Health Professions in Detroit Michigan and his Doctor of Osteopathy at the MSU College of Osteopathic Medicine in East Lansing, Michigan. He holds membership in the American Osteopathic Association, Michigan Association of Osteopathic Physicians and Surgeons, Oakland County Osteopathic Society and the Michigan State Medical Society. He was appointed as Chief Medical Consultant to the Public Health Committee of the Michigan House of Representatives in 1994, and Associate Clinical Professor of Michigan State University's College of Osteopathic Medicine in 2004. Working for the health of the community is a priority with Dr. Paul. In addition to being both the volunteer team physician for Kimball and Dondero Senior High Schools and volunteer medical consultant for the Royal Oak Senior Center since 1984, he is a volunteer member of the Royal Oak Prevention Coalition. He has served Royal Oak Schools for many years as a member of the Curriculum Committee, the Immunization Action Committee, and sponsors parent supervision of the senior proms as well as the Howard Alderman Memorial Student Athlete Scholastic Award. In addition, he was advisor to the Michigan State Medical Society's statewide obesity conference last year. He is a community preventative-health advocate and activist whose mission is to positively affect children with healthy lifestyles. |


Paul R. Ehrmann, D.O. is the founder, owner and medical director of the Family Health Care Center in Royal Oak. He is Board Certified by the American College of Osteopathic Physicians and has operated his private practice since 1982.
